Crab shells are a great addition to your compost pile, as they are a source of calcium, nitrogen, and phosphorus. However, it is important to compost crab shells correctly in order to avoid attracting pests and creating a smelly mess.

Preparation of crab shells for composting

Before composting crab shells, it is important to rinse them off to remove any salt or other debris. You can also crush the shells into smaller pieces to help them break down faster.

Methods of composting crab shells

There are a few different ways to compost crab shells. You can:

  • Add them directly to your compost pile.
  • Bury them in your garden.
  • Make a crab shell compost tea.

Tips for composting crab shells

Here are a few tips for composting crab shells:

  • Add them to your compost pile in small batches.
  • Mix them well with other compost materials.
  • Water your compost pile regularly.
  • Turn your compost pile every few weeks to help the crab shells break down faster.

How long does it take for crab shells to decompose?

Crab shells can take anywhere from 6 months to 2 years to decompose completely. The exact time frame depends on the conditions of the compost pile, such as the temperature, moisture level, and the presence of other organic matter.

What can I do to compost crab shells faster?

There are a few things you can do to compost crab shells faster. First, you can crush the shells into smaller pieces. This will make them easier for the microorganisms in the compost pile to break down. Second, you can add a source of nitrogen to the compost pile, such as manure or blood meal. Nitrogen helps to speed up the decomposition process. Finally, you can keep the compost pile moist. Moisture is essential for the microorganisms to thrive.
